Maintenance For 18+ Months by Creative-Carry-4299 in tirzepatidecompound

[–]Informal-Wait3033 1 point2 points  (0 children)

My body said done at 160 which is fine, my Dexascan metrics are excellent for a woman of my age. I “plateaued” at this weight for months and decided this is my healthy weight and though not a 2, I don’t remember being an 8 before. I have not been able to drop my dose. I don’t get hunger or food noise when I drop but I do gain weight and I know this is working at a metabolic level and my system needs it. Highest dose, 10 mg/wk and maintaining on that. Over the last approximately 9 months of maintenance, which for me really means accepting that I am not going to get skinny skinny, I have stayed between 155-158 without stress. I just donated my big girl clothes last week, feeling confident Tirz and good habits will allow me to continued to be strong slender.
